TCP/IP协议
出错信息:
拒绝存取

解决方案 »

  1.   

    NT上有没有运行scktsrvr.exe
    在delphi/bin下可以找到。
      

  2.   

    不能在客户端运行服务器!否则客户程序将访问本地服务器。
    在服务器端运行SCKTSRVR.exe 
      

  3.   

      因该不是你程序的问题吧 ,我听说在网络中不同机器上运行使用了MIDAS控件的程序必须向INPRISE 购买MIDAS的分发授权,大约一个站点需要¥6000.00。
      

  4.   

    要在NT sever上运行服务器一次以注册。
    scktsrvr.exe好像不需要吧,用socket联时才需要。
      

  5.   

    服务器端注册服务器程序,运行SCKTSRVR。EXE,注意将接口GUID加入到SCKTSRVR中,另外还应该注意的是SCKTSRVR和客户程序SocketConnection端口号要一致。
      

  6.   

    在服务器端运行服务程序一次,再运行SCKTSRVR,在SCKTSRVR中增加端口,将服务接口GUID加入新增端口。
      客户端用SocketConnection,设计时注意端口号,服务器地址。我想就没有什么其它问题了。
      

  7.   

    你在NT机器上很可能没有Midas许可,你可以在NT上安装Delphi,
    可以骗过去
      

  8.   

    可能是NT权限设置的问题。请在NT上打开dcomcnfg.exe,查看你的server程序的access premissions.将allow access-->everyone,allow launch-->everyone再试。